Honeymoon Pool – Stones Brook Camp at Wellington National Park
Where To Stay Wellington Forest, Dardanup, Western Australia
Located in Wellington National Park, Honeymoon Pool-Stones Brook has access to its namesake brook near its confluence with the Collie River, making it a great spot for enjoying swimming, canoeing and kayaking.
There are also a number of walk and cycle trails in the National Park, including the Munda Middi off-road cycle trail.
The campground features 20 individual campsites suitable for tents only.
A camp kitchen is provided with gas barbecues, burner rings for cooking pots, a dishwashing sink, picnic tables and benches.
Campers are advised to bring enough drinking water for the duration of their stay.
Campfires are not permitted.
